Interesting they have Brady Martin at #7

7. Brady Martin, C (Soo Greyhounds, OHL)​

There has been a ton of discourse recently as to whether Martin is a top-10 pick. Here’s what I’ll say: this is a guy you win with. He’s built for the playoffs like Brad Marchand, so undervalue him at your own peril. Martin played at more than a point per game in the OHL, doing a lot of heavy lifting for the Soo. He was also one of the best players at both the Hlinka Gretzky Cup and the U-18 World Championship. Away from the puck, He hits everyone in sight, constantly battles hard for the puck and is a noted goal-scorer, too. He doesn’t always have top-level players to play with on the Greyhounds, but he does look like one of the best players to come out of the OHL this year because he does so much all over the ice and never gives up on a play. Martin is a center, but I think he’ll be better suited on the wing in the NHL.
